Local legend tells that Hell's Hole was discovered by 2 men travelling at night. At hight peering down in this hole one would have thought that it probably did go all the way to hell or perhaps, that's where they would of ended up had they fallen in.
Hell's Hole is popular spot for abseiling cave divers and is 45m metres in diameter, with 30 metres to the water which is about 25 metres deep.
